Methodical Instructions regarding sanitary and biological valuation of fishing water basins (No.13-4-2/1742 of 1999).
This content is exclusively provided by FAO / FAOLEX / ECOLEX
The principal condition for efficient production of the objects of aquaculture in fishing water basins is the observance of veterinary and sanitary requirements.
